France, Sept. 11 -- Children under 15 in France should be banned from using social media, while those aged 15 to 18 should face a night-time "digital curfew", a French parliamentary committee urged on Thursday.
The recommendations follow a six-month inquiry into the psychological effects of TikTok on minors.
Laure Miller, who led the investigation, said the app's addictive design and algorithm "has been copied by other social media".
"Of course, banning children under 15 from social media should not be the tree that hides the forest," Miller told fellow MPs before the report's publication. "This is one measure among many, not a panacea."
